Thread: Range mod change suggestion
I have a laser rifle with an ideal of 60m and is +20 at that range. The max range is 64m and is -50. That is a 70 point difference for 4m or about 12ft. Seems a bit extreme to me. So here is what I think would be a good fix.
Make the modifiers be based on how far from ideal they are. For example : -15 for every 10m from ideal or something like that. This would make a rifle as bad at close range as a pistol would be at long range. Carbines would be in the middle with their close and long range mods about the same. This would also simply the weapon screen as max and close wouldn't have to be listed anymore. Just list the ideal and the mods per 10m from that. You could even make the rates different for different weapons. Laser rifle is -12 per 10m while the DLT is -15 per 10m or whatever.
Seems like it would be a fairly simple system to use. Better than the -70 for 4m yet it's only -100 for 60m if I compare my ideal and my point blank.
I'll leave it to the mathmeticians to figure out how but as long as the 3 wepons end up living in 3 seperate ranges, I'll be happy.
